Things To Do This Weekend 2-5 Oct

This weekend get immersed in Italian films or silent movies, visit a mega LEGO expo, revisite 1 1990s classic movie live on a vintage bus or get lost in a dreamy performance of fairytale themes.For something new, check out the secret new Valley wine bar awash with vintage charm, or the new espresso bar in a city lane, try a famous burger in a northside cafe bar or head to the bay to check out the new homewares design shop and cute indie bookshop cafe.

And make time for breakfast and shopping at one of Brisbane's 3 best suburban farmer's markets.

Then for those with children how about a strawbery farm adventure, an enchanting piece of theatre with The Gruffao's Child or a visit to Brisbane's very first Fun Palace where science meets art with mind-blowing results.

Roaring Twenties Cinema

Spend a  night at the movies 1920's style on Friday night at historic Paddington Hall, with a feature film from the silent era, newsreels, cartoons, old previews and serials all for just $10...more

Suburban Farmers Markets

Mitchelton Farmers Market

This Sunday morning Blackwood Street comes to life with its monthly Jan Powers farmers market - the perfect place to stock up on fresh produce, gourmet goods and enjoy a multicultural breakfast...more

Brisbane Farmers Market

From the folks behind the iconic Noosa Farmers market is the east side's Sunday morning go-to for top quality fruit and veges, free range eggs, medicinal honey, artisan breads and pasta and more

Manly Farmers Market

This dog-friendly village-style market on the waterfront at Manly is an idyllic way to spend a Saturday morning as well as a great spot to pick up some trawler-fresh seafood...more
